Subject: Re: [PATCH] tests/qtest/boot-serial-test: Add support on LoongArch system
Date: Wed, 8 May 2024 17:17:21 +0800	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<e3d419c0-a1f3-9158-fccd-db6931cc4757@loongson.cn>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<4ce31fa5-16b0-491c-9956-35ed68af2a6f@redhat.com>



On 2024/5/8 下午5:00, Thomas Huth wrote:
> On 08/05/2024 10.55, Bibo Mao wrote:
>> Add boot-serial-test test case support on LoongArch system.
> 
> ... and also the filter tests?
yes, it is :) Will update changelog in next version.

> 
>> Signed-off-by: Bibo Mao <maobibo@loongson.cn>
>> ---
>>   tests/qtest/boot-serial-test.c | 10 ++++++++++
>>   tests/qtest/meson.build        |  4 ++++
>>   2 files changed, 14 insertions(+)
>>
>> diff --git a/tests/qtest/boot-serial-test.c 
>> b/tests/qtest/boot-serial-test.c
>> index e3b7d65fe5..631015e8c8 100644
>> --- a/tests/qtest/boot-serial-test.c
>> +++ b/tests/qtest/boot-serial-test.c
>> @@ -129,6 +129,14 @@ static const uint8_t kernel_stm32vldiscovery[] = {
>>       0x04, 0x38, 0x01, 0x40                  /* 0x40013804 = USART1 
>> TXD */
>>   };
>> +static const uint8_t bios_loongarch64[] = {
>> +    0x0c, 0xc0, 0x3f, 0x14,            /* lu12i.w $t0,  0x1fe00    */
>> +    0x8c, 0x81, 0x87, 0x03,            /* ori     $t0,  $t0, 0x1e0 */
>> +    0x0d, 0x50, 0x81, 0x03,            /* li.w    $t1,  'T'        */
>> +    0x8d, 0x01, 0x00, 0x29,            /* st.b    $t1, $t0,  0     */
>> +    0xff, 0xf3, 0xff, 0x53,            /*  b      -16  #loop       */
>> +};
>> +
>>   typedef struct testdef {
>>       const char *arch;       /* Target architecture */
>>       const char *machine;    /* Name of the machine */
>> @@ -181,6 +189,8 @@ static const testdef_t tests[] = {
>>       { "arm", "microbit", "", "T", sizeof(kernel_nrf51), kernel_nrf51 },
>>       { "arm", "stm32vldiscovery", "", "T",
>>         sizeof(kernel_stm32vldiscovery), kernel_stm32vldiscovery },
>> +    { "loongarch64", "virt", "-cpu max", "TT", sizeof(bios_loongarch64),
>> +      NULL, bios_loongarch64 },
>>       { NULL }
>>   };
>> diff --git a/tests/qtest/meson.build b/tests/qtest/meson.build
>> index 6f2f594ace..6619b630e6 100644
>> --- a/tests/qtest/meson.build
>> +++ b/tests/qtest/meson.build
>> @@ -256,6 +256,10 @@ qtests_s390x = \
>>   qtests_riscv32 = \
>>     (config_all_devices.has_key('CONFIG_SIFIVE_E_AON') ? 
>> ['sifive-e-aon-watchdog-test'] : [])
>> + qtests_loongarch64 = \
>> +  qtests_filter + \
>> +  ['boot-serial-test']
> 
> It's already a little bit messed up, but I think we originally had the 
> entries in alphabetical order, so I'd like to suggest to add this 
> between qtests_hppa and qtests_m68k instead.
sure, will do.
